The Granby Land Trust is a member-supported, nonprofit organization. We rely on the support of people like you to help us preserve Granby’s natural heritage and Granby's natural resources. For as little as $30, you can begin to make a difference. Your gift will ensure people have places to connect with nature. It will protect agricultural and support local food production. And it will preserve Granby's natural beauty and rural character.
As a member, you will receive notices about lectures, hikes, work parties, and other special events, including our Annual Meeting. You will receive our newsletter, which will keep you abreast of our land acquisitions and land management activities. And you will have the satisfaction of doing something good for Granby and the planet.
